Germany’s leadership in coating and sizing chemistry stems from its precision manufacturing standards and industrial automation infrastructure. Formulations within these categories are carefully engineered to maintain surface adhesion, resistance to deformation, and effective moisture regulation during fiber weaving and finishing. Colorants and auxiliaries sustain Germany’s global foothold in coloration technology, advancing precision dyeing techniques that adhere to environmental controls banning toxic metals, azo dyes, and hazardous dispersants. Modern auxiliaries blend digital coloration with resourcesaving processes applicable to fashion, automotive, and technical sectors seeking vibrant yet sustainable outcomes. Finishing chemicals represent Germany’s most intensively innovated type class, addressing antishrinkage, antimicrobial, and hydrophobic characteristics through silicone hybrids, enzyme stabilizers, and nanolinked polymers. Desizing agents integrate enzymatic systems calibrated to decompose natural sizing films, optimizing lowtemperature operation and streamlining textile cleaning efficiency within energy conservation guidelines. German formulators further extend their reach across auxiliary subcategories brighteners, lubricants, and resins ensuring compatibility between organic fabrics and synthetics within exportbound textile lines. Each formulation emphasizes waste reduction and compliance with European REACH and Green Deal objectives, maintaining equilibrium between comfort, precision, and sustainability. The resulting type structure underpins Germany’s identity as a progressive, standardsdriven textile chemical market distinguished by its seamless fusion of scientific exactitude and responsible industrial evolution.

Plantbased cotton, hemp, and linen fibers represent vital feedstocks within Germany’s textile chain, drawing chemical enhancements that promote dye fixation, tensile reinforcement, and resistance to microbial degradation while conserving fiber tactility. Manmade cellulosic fabrics such as viscose, lyocell, and modal receive reactive coatings tailored to promote soft drape, dimensional balance, and humidity control significant to apparel design. Synthetic polymers like polyester, acrylic, and nylon dominate within technical textiles, utilizing surfaceactive agents, dispersion stabilizers, and ultraviolet modulators to ensure stability under rigorous industrial environments. Investment in clean polymerization and solvent recovery systems promotes digitaldriven chemical blending that reduces carbon intensity without compromising textile robustness. Animal fibers such as wool and silk remain niche yet crucial, supporting Germany’s luxury textile segment through precision treatments ensuring pH stabilization, smoothness, and biosafe sheen retention. Research gradients highlight renewable resource exploration such as polylactic acid and mixed biocomposite strands for highperformance blends compatible with circular production cycles. German laboratories experiment on enzyme and esterification mechanisms to bond biofibers into highyield matrices replacing petrochemical dependents. The synthesis processes across each material class align with Germany’s policies on industrial ecology and sustainable manufacturing, merging material innovation with environmental stewardship. Such integration defines an ecosystem where theoretical chemistry translates directly into practical textile resilience and product appeal.

Chemicals engineered for German apparel markets intertwine functionality and design, manifesting in weatherproof, stretchenhanced, and colorfast clothing responding to global performancewear trends. Home furnishing applications focus on enhancing tactile refinement, UV shielding, and stainproof processing integrated into curtains, carpets, and upholstery crafted for extended longevity under indoor environmental conditions. Automotive textiles represent a pivotal vertical emphasizing abrasion resistance, flame retardancy, and coating stability critical for seat upholstery, insulation coverings, and trunk liners. Industrial textile segments apply cuttingedge silicones and thermal stabilizers ensuring uniform flexibility and structural resilience vital in filtration fabrics and composites used in heavy machinery and construction. Specialty categories encompassing healthcare uniforms, sportswear, and hygiene materials rely on antibacterial chelation systems, moisture absorption enhancers, and smart chemical finishes compatible with bodyadaptive textile pathways.
